At In4Care, our focus is always on our clients and making sure they feel safe, supported, and respected.
That’s why we make proper staff training a priority, working closely with our Registered Nurse to ensure our team has the right skills and knowledge. This includes safe manual handling, so our clients are supported in a way that protects their comfort, dignity, and wellbeing.
When our staff are well trained and confident, our clients receive better care. For us, it’s about doing things properly and making sure every person we support gets the best care possible.

Client Testimonial – Tasha
At In4Care, we are proud to support Tasha and value the positive feedback she has shared about her experience with our service. Tasha has told us that she enjoys being supported by In4Care because “the staff are kind, respectful, and genuinely care about my wellbeing.” Hearing that our team “take the time to listen to me, understand my needs, and support me in a way that helps me feel comfortable and supported” reflects the person-centred values we strive to uphold every day.
Tasha has also shared how important it is for her to be encouraged to engage with the community. She appreciates that our staff “help me get out and socialise, and encourage me to do things that sometimes make me feel anxious,” supporting her to build confidence while feeling safe and respected.
When receiving support, Tasha enjoys a variety of meaningful activities. She has shared that her support workers take her fishing, do “lots of cooking,” and spend time doing “arts and craft activities.” She also enjoys “going out to see animals” and especially loves “going on trips out of town seeing places that I don’t get to see often.”
We are grateful that Tasha has trusted In4Care to support her and are committed to continuing to provide compassionate, respectful, and individualised support that enhances her wellbeing and quality of life.

🎉 New Year, New Job? 🎉
Start 2026 with a role that truly makes a difference! 💛
Join the IN4CARE Team as a Casual Support Worker and help bring smiles to people’s lives every day.
✨ What you’ll need (or be willing to get):
✔ Certificate III in Individual Support (or similar)
✔ First Aid & CPR
✔ NDIS Worker Screening Check
✔ NDIS Orientation Module
✔ Aussie driver’s licence
✔ Right to work in Australia
💡 Perks?
✅ Flexible hours
✅ A supportive, fun team
✅ The chance to create a culture of care every day!
